Bergen Community VP From Hillsdale Recognized By Honor Society

HILLSDALE, N.J. -- Academic Vice President William Mullaney, Ph.D., of Hillsdale was recognized with the Regional Coordinator Award for Chapter Administrators at Bergen Community College's honor society.

He was among five faculty and student leaders who achieved international and regional recognition.

Bergen Community College’s Alpha Epsilon Phi chapter of Phi Theta Kappa, the honor society of two-year institutions, recently earned recognition as one of the top 30 chapters in the world.

The awards were announced at the honor society’s annual conference – “NerdNation” – April 7-9 in Maryland.

Nationwide, approximately 91 percent of Phi Theta Kappa members earn an associate degree or transfer to a four-year institution, compared to the national rate of 38 percent.
